One of the participants gathers for the weekly ''Bearing Witness standout'' and holds a ''Grantifa'' sign outside ICE headquarters in Burlington, Massachusetts, on January 14, 2026. Grantifa is a play on words, blending ''grandmother'' and ''Antifa''.

Locals fly kites while celebrating Poush Sankranti during the Shakrain Festival in Dhaka, Bangladesh, on January 14, 2026. Shakrain is an annual celebration marking the end of the Bengali month of Poush and is traditionally observed with kite flying and other activities.

Assamese people gather to light a traditional 'Meji' bonfire while celebrating the Magh Bihu festival in Guwahati, India, on January 14, 2026. The Meji, constructed from bamboo and straw, is ceremonially burned as part of Bhogali Bihu to mark the harvest season and communal festivities.
